TWO CHINESE IMARI ARMORIAL DISHES
CIRCA 1718-20
Each painted with a central flowerhead amid gilt-enriched flowering vine and birds, the border with either a leopard's face crest for the Child family, or a demi-seahorse crest for Page of Hampshire
12 in. (30.4 cm.) diameter (2)
